DESCRIPTION:Historic Wilson Hall\nDesignated a Historical Landmark in 1985\nNovember 1 – December 21\, 2012\nPollak Gallery\nFree & Open to Public\nThe splendor of the golden age of American palaces will be featured in  an exhibit of photographs depicting Shadow lawn estate as it appeared from 1903 through 1937. The exhibit features images of the original colonial wood frame structure built in 1903 that was destroyed by fire in 1927\, and the neoclassical French limestone structure that replaced it in 1929. The exhibit includes images of President Woodrow Wilson making his acceptance speech on the steps  of Shadow Lawn\, the opulent décor of the interiors\, and the greenhouses and grounds that supported the estate.\n\nThis exhibition is part of an ongoing historical project that we hope to grow and enhance by learning more through oral histories and individual memories. DESCRIPTION:A traditional sell-out at the Pollak Theatre\, the annual Christmas\nconcert by the beloved homegrown institution returns for its 22nd\nshowcase of sacred carols and seasonal favorites. It’s a landmark local\nevent without which the holidays would seem incomplete — keynoted with\nthe grace and humor of Father Alphonse Stevenson\, the conductor in the\nclerical collar whose formidable resume boasts stints as a Brigadier\nGeneral in the US Air National Guard\, and music director for the 1980s\nBroadway run of A Chorus Line.  \nMore info: www.orchsp.com

Runtime: 3:54 \nAccompanied by a thrilling score\, Verdi’s vivid characters grapple with life and love\, betrayal and death. Director David Alden’s dreamlike setting provides a compelling backdrop for this dramatic story of jealousy and vengeance. Marcelo Álvarez stars as the conflicted king; Karita Mattila is Amelia\, the object of his secret passion; and Dmitri Hvorostovsky is her suspicious husband. Kathleen Kim is the page Oscar\, and mezzo-soprano powerhouses Dolora Zajick and Stephanie Blythe take turns singing the fortuneteller Ulrica. Fabio Luisi conducts. \nProduction a gift of the Betsy and Edward Cohen/Areté Foundation Fund for New Productions and Revivals
